Jackets are quilted and lined with front button closures. Jacket A has a round collar, front, bottom and sleeve edges are finished with purchased bias tape. The outer edges of Jacket B are finished with purchased bias tape. Skirt C has gathers, front waistband and back elastic casing. Pants D has elastic casing at waist, topstitching details. FABRICS: Designed for light to medium-weight woven fabrics. Suggested Fabrics: Broadcloth, calico, denim, pinwale corduroy.
This sewing pattern comes with a 1:1 pattern for different garment sizes. Using a tracing wheel, you can draw the pattern directly to the fabric or precut from tracing paper.
